The Bluegrass Rogue bicycle helmet is designed for cyclists who love mountain biking. It features a simple color scheme, an interesting shape with many vents, sun protection, and technological solutions that make it a model that cannot go unnoticed.
The helmet has been developed using the popular in-mold technology, which means it has an outer shell permanently connected to an inner layer of EPS foam. This solution allows for the creation of a model that is not only durable but also lightweight.
The Rogue's adjustment is ideal for every head size, with the comfortable Safe-T Heta adjustment system and dedicated dial. Combined with a buckle, it guarantees stability and, consequently, safety.
The helmet's design has been developed to ensure a high level of protection while allowing the user to enjoy a truly pleasant ride. The shape includes 16 vents, making it ideal for demanding MTB disciplines.
The designers at Bluegrass also ensured that the lining stands out with features that enhance performance. For this reason, they used hypoallergenic Coolmax, which provides breathability and reduces skin sweating.
An important convenience for many users is the functional visor. This is a detachable element that allows for easy adaptation of the model to preferences and current road conditions. Additionally, it features openings for the placement of glasses. At the back of the helmet, there are elements for adjusting ski goggles.
Bluegrass pays attention to details, one of which is the space for a ponytail, allowing cyclists with long hair to ride with their hair tied back.
